Output e5c84aeb2954eb56f29d7f0fdabca826f73582d0ccc1e4e2a538f197066c80bc: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4529fed47770cdb678b7914989a59917cf466158 OP_EQUALVERIFY OP_CHECKSIG
address
17Jhw8XxnPFfXXjfGzWXoUZtBBGJGy8RLx
transaction
e5c84aeb2954eb56f29d7f0fdabca826f73582d0ccc1e4e2a538f197066c80bc
confirmations
576402
spent
true